WordReference Random House Unabridged Dictionary of American English © 2024
plen•i•tude  (pleni to̅o̅d′, -tyo̅o̅d′),USA pronunciation n. 
  1. fullness or adequacy in quantity, measure, or degree;
    abundance:a plenitude of food, air, and sunlight.
  2. state of being full or complete.
  • Latin plēnitūdō. See plenum, -i-, tude
  • late Middle English 1375–1425

Collins Concise English Dictionary © HarperCollins Publishers::
plenitude /ˈplɛnɪˌtjuːd/ n
  1. abundance; copiousness
  2. the condition of being full or complete
Etymology: 15th Century: via Old French from Latin plēnitūdō, from plēnus full
